HOW TO LISTEN EXTERNAL SONGS?
-------------------------

	Create wormz.m3u playlist with Winamp or other compatible program to your game
	directory. Include the songs to playlist that you want to be played during game.

HOW TO MAKE EXTERNAL LEVELS?
----------------------------

	Draw a 800x600 pcx-picture with 16-bit colors. The level should not be smaller than
	this even while it works. If color is not bright pink then worm can't pass that pixel
	and dies. Save it to game directory with name: lev<highestnumber>.pcx.
	Example: lev11.pcx.

HOW TO USE EXTERNAL LEVELS?
---------------------------

	Start game with parameters: <highest level number>
	Example (with one new level): wormz 11
	This should be automated, sorry.
